Original Description
Christian Martin Tegner's Fiskere på Hornbæk Strand (Fishermen at Hornbæk Beach) is a luminous depiction of 19th-century Danish coastal life, radiating both tranquility and the raw vigor of manual labor. Painted in 1872, it belongs to the Golden Age of Danish art, a period marked by naturalism and national romanticism. The scene portrays fishermen hauling their boats ashore, bathed in delicate Nordic light that softens the toil yet accentuates the figures' stoic determination. Tegner’s precise brushwork and muted yet harmonious palette—think weathered blues, sandy ochres, and pearly skies—evoke a quiet dignity, bridging realism with poetic atmosphere. While lesser-known internationally than his contemporaries like P.C. Skovgaard, Tegner’s work holds significance for its ethnographic detail and embodiment of Denmark’s maritime heritage. The painting’s balance of genre realism and lyrical light effects positions it as a subtle gem of Scandinavian art history.
